BNSF 4560 has blue nose door
Posted by Lyon_Wonder on Friday, February 29, 2008 9:29 PM

Recently, BNSF 4560 has been spotted with a nose door from what I guess would be a Conrail GE engine.  Notice the letters AIL and ITY.  Conrail never had Dash 9s on their roster.  So the nose doors on the wide cab Dash 8s, 9s and maybe GEvos must be identical.
